git 多个人可以用一个账号吗
发布网友
发布时间:2022-05-10 03:26
我来回答
共4个回答
热心网友
时间:2023-10-27 07:25
可以的。但是需要附加条件和设置才行。只举一例。方法如下:
用ssh-keygen命令生成ssh密钥文件
1、如果本机上已经添加过git帐号则找到密钥文件目录。否则跳到3。
一般都是在“~/.ssh”(我的是 C:\Users\【用户名】\.ssh)。
2、如果之前建立密钥时,没有设定名字,则原默认是直接F2修改当前目录下的密钥文件的名字
3、为自己的github帐号创建相应的密钥
在~/.ssh目录下右键执行Git Bash Here,一定要在~/.ssh路径下运行命令行,不然生成的文件不会出现在当前目录。$ ssh-keygen -t rsa -C "your@gmail.com"
先不要一路回车,在第一个对话的时候输入重命名(id_rsa_myself),如:
Enter file in which to save the key (/c/Users/WJ/.ssh/id_rsa): id_rsa_myself (这里输入我们定义的名字以便和其它的有区别, 然后一路回车)
4、生成完成后,会在本地的ssh目录下出现刚刚生成的密钥文件
5、部署SSH key这里就不讲各个平台了,已GitHub为例:进入Personal settings –> SSH and GPG keys:点击"new SSH key", 把公钥(.pub结尾)的内容分别添加到相应的github账号中。
热心网友
时间:2023-10-27 07:25
当然可以,但是一般都不这样用。都是多个账号编辑同一个code。
https://my.oschina.net/bgq365/blog/819097
这个是同一台机器如何同时使用多个Git账号
热心网友
时间:2023-10-27 07:26
可以。
每个终端用不同的 git config user.name 作为日志区分一下。
热心网友
时间:2023-10-27 07:26
可以。。但是这样不能区分代码到底是谁提交的
git 多个人可以用一个账号吗
可以的。但是需要附加条件和设置才行。只举一例。方法如下:用ssh-keygen命令生成ssh密钥文件 1、如果本机上已经添加过git帐号则找到密钥文件目录。否则跳到3。一般都是在“~/.ssh”(我的是 C:\Users\【用户名】\.ssh)。2、如果之前建立密钥时,没有设定名字,则原默认是直接F2修改当前目录下的...
Git 使用时的账号和邮箱问题???
可以操作多个git,但是这个用户名和邮箱是用来标识你这个人的,比如谁提交code,对于一个人来说,不管他访问多少个git、,一般都是用同一个邮箱,用户名来标识这个开发者
如何用同一个github帐号在两台电脑上同步开发
解决方案是两套key,再写个配置文件,注意生成两个Key时,不要随便输入enter键就就不会覆盖掉老的两个key (假设你已经拥有私有账号且已经OK,现在想使用另一个工作用账号):1:为工作账号生成SSH Key ssh-keygen -t rsa -C "your-email-address"存储key的时候,不要覆盖现有的id_rsa,在生成两...
换了一台电脑用一个git账号 需要重新生成一个ssh key吗
我也去答题访问个人页 关注 展开全部 如果两台电脑(公司和私人)都要使用同一个git账号管理项目,那就在git(码云、Github)里面配置两台电脑分别对应的SSH Key,SSH Key生成是:执行 ssh-keygen -t rsa -C "email@example.com",连按三次enter键,会看到生成了 一个id_rsa.pub文件,然后执行cat id_rsa.pub ...
在windows和mac中怎么共用同一个git账号
然后一直回车,建议不要输密码,然后找到~/.ssh 3. 接下来,将windows的id_rsa替换掉mac生成的id_rsa 4. 然后输入chmod0600~/.ssh/id_rsa命令添加权限 5. 接下来,输入ssh-add-K~/.ssh/id_rsa 6. 如图,就可以git clone了。以上就是在windows和mac中怎么共用同一个git账号的具体操作步骤。
Git分布式系统---Gitlab多人工作流程
在多人协作中,团队成员通常分为管理员和开发人员两个角色。管理员负责创建仓库和合并代码,他们也可以作为开发人员参与项目。开发人员的任务则包括根据功能需求编写代码。每位参与者在使用Gitlab前需要注册账号。管理员需要掌握的关键步骤包括在Gitlab网站上创建仓库、设置开发人员权限以及刷新Gitlab页面。开发...
git服务器里如何为各个开发者设置用户名和密码呢?
1. 创建用户账号 在Git服务器上,你需要为每位开发者创建一个独立的用户账号。这通常涉及到操作系统级别的用户管理。在Linux系统中,可以使用`useradd`命令来添加新用户;在Windows系统中,则通过控制面板或使用PowerShell来创建新用户。每个用户账号都需要一个唯一的用户名。2. 设置密码 为新创建的用户...
共用服务器多git账号配置
一台共用服务器上多人共同使用,多个git工程每个工程的地址和账号密码又是不一样。使用global 此时在/home/usrname下.gitconfig 会生成设置全局的git用户名及邮箱账号 如下命令可谓单个工程设置用户名及邮箱账号,存放在工程目录下.git/config文件中 1.首先为不同的工程配置不同的Git账号 注意:这里git...
本地git 账号关联远程 github/gitlab/gitee | git 本地如何配置多平台账...
为了适应工作和学习需求,我们需要在本地账号与远程平台之间建立关联。公司使用的 GitLab账号与个人学习使用的GitHub账号不能共用,因此需要分别配置,保证个人研究与公司项目分账管理。二、关联账号 为了将本地账号与远程平台关联,从而实现代码提交,以下以GitHub为例进行说明:1、本地生成SSH密钥 首先,进入...
怎么在一台电脑上配置两个git账号
一般情况下,我们都是一台电脑配置一个git账号,可以是GitHub账号,也可以是 oschina(码云)账号或者是gitLab账号。我之前用过GitHub和oschina,今天公司配置了一个内部的gitLab。这就涉及到一个问题,如何在一台电脑上配置两个或者是两个以上的git账号。这里以在一台电脑上同时配置oschina(码云)账号和...